Last Updated: Friday, 26 May 2023, 13:32 GMT
Latest Refworld Updates for India RSS feed

India - flag India

Filter:
Showing 1-1 of 1 result
India: Government fails to address key human rights concerns during UN review

21 September 2017 | Publisher: International Federation for Human Rights | Document type: Country News

Search Refworld